Everything You Need to Know About 239 Series CA/CC Spherical Roller Bearings


Release time:

2024-03-17

Spherical roller bearings are essential components in various industrial equipment, providing support for rotating shafts while accommodating misalignment and axial displacement. The 239 Series CA/CC Spherical Roller Bearings are known for their high load-carrying capacity and robust design, making them ideal for heavy-duty applications.
These bearings are designed with a symmetrical roller profile and optimized internal geometry to ensure enhanced load distribution and reduced friction. The CA design features a machined brass cage, while the CC design incorporates a stamped steel cage. Both designs offer excellent performance in demanding operating conditions.
When selecting 239 Series CA/CC Spherical Roller Bearings for your application, it is crucial to consider factors such as load capacity, operating speed, misalignment tolerance, and lubrication requirements. Proper installation and maintenance practices also play a significant role in maximizing the service life of these bearings.
In conclusion, 239 Series CA/CC Spherical Roller Bearings are reliable components that offer high performance and durability in industrial applications. By understanding their design features and application considerations, you can make informed decisions when choosing bearings for your equipment.
